Output 18f52c6a2d7698d28c2b52ad275999f6a40ecfc10b61f745bdacc469a17143ed:14

value
1689446
script pubkey
OP_0 OP_PUSHBYTES_20 ee6f0ddbbb562731977a25affbfcc4139cfe8af1
address
bc1qaehsmkam2cnnr9m6ykhlhlxyzww0azh3ejxqzm
transaction
18f52c6a2d7698d28c2b52ad275999f6a40ecfc10b61f745bdacc469a17143ed